MP Since - 1992 Majority - 6,451 Born - 09/01/1952, Married, 1 son, 1 daughter.
Education - Haileybury School, Bristol University, York University.
Previous Occupation - National Officer (NALGO) (1975-82). General Secretary International Broadcasting Trust (making films on the Environment & International Development for Channel 4) (1982-86), Lecturer in Social Policy at the University of York (1986-92). Research Fellow in Health Economics (1987-92).
Personal Overview - A moderate Labour member, with University and Trade Union experience. He has interests in Health, economic policy, World Development and reform of the electoral system. As a past instigator and General Secretary of the International Broadcasting Trust, he is likely to have an interest in the media and 'Information Superhighway' issues. Had a short ministerial spell at the old DSS prior to the 2001 election and has remained on the back benches since then.
Political History - Councillor, Camden Borough Council (1980-86), Member of the York Authority (1988-90), MP York (1992-2010), MP York Central (2010-). Member Health Select Committee (1992-97). Introduced a Bill to curb Tobacco advertising. Former Chairman of the Overseas Development All Party Group, and former Joint Vice Chairman of the Parliamentary Labour Party International Development Committee (until 1999), Chairman (2001-). Chairman of Africa All-Party Parliamentary Group. PPS at the Department of Health (1997-99) (to Rt. Hon Frank Dobson MP).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State at the Department of Social Security (1999-2001). Member of the International Development Select Committee (2001-). Member of the Chairman's Panel (2005-).
Characteristics - Particularly conscious of health issues. Member of the NATO Parliamentary Assembly, the Commonwealth Parliamentary Association and a delegate to the Organisation for Security and Co-operation in Europe. MEP Since - 2009 Born - 1947. Divorced, 2 daughters and 4 granddaughters.
Education - N/a.
Previous Occupation - Retired College Lecturer in Politics and Law (Harrogate College).
Personal Overview - Elected to the European Parliament at the 2009 elections. A long term British Nationalist, he has experience of standing for parliament several times. He is opposed to the UK's membership of the European Union, but is willing to work with people from all countries of Europe to bring the EU formally to an end. He makes a distinction between his opposition to the EU and Europe in general, stating that he is not 'anti European'.
Political History - Joined the original British Nationalist Party and National Front in 1965. General Election candidate for Harrogate (February and October 1974), Birmingham Stechford by-election (1977), General Election candidate for Bradford North (1979) and Leeds East (1983). Joined the current BNP (2006). MEP Yorkshire and the Humber Region (2009-). Member of the Delegation to the EU-Croatia Joint Parliamentary Committee (2009-). Member of the Committee on Constitutional Affairs (2009-). Substitute member of the Committee on Civil Liberties, Justice and Home Affairs (2009-).
Other Information - Enjoys the English countryside and walking his dogs and riding horses. Likes the radio series 'In Our Time'.
